Career Highlights
Born on June 10, 1965, in Basingstoke, Hampshire, Liz Hurley began her career in the late 1980s with minor television roles before gaining significant recognition in the 1990s. She became the face of Estée Lauder in 1995, a partnership that would solidify her status in the fashion world. The iconic black dress she wore to the premiere of “Four Weddings and a Funeral” in 1994 propelled her into the public eye, making her a style icon. Her career subsequently flourished with notable roles in films and television series, including “Austin Powers: International Man of Mystery” and the series “The Royals.”
Philanthropic Endeavours
In addition to her successful career in entertainment, Hurley is deeply committed to charitable work. She has supported numerous causes, particularly those related to cancer research and children’s health. Liz has worked with organizations like The Breast Cancer Research Foundation and has been an outspoken advocate for the importance of funding for cancer research. Her efforts have raised significant awareness and money for these critical causes, demonstrating her commitment to making a difference beyond the spotlight.
